What is Live-In Care?

Live-in care means a professional carer moves into your home to provide round-the-clock support, tailored to your needs. This option allows you to stay in familiar surroundings, maintain independence, and enjoy one-to-one care—something care homes rarely offer.

Care Home Costs: The Reality

According to industry data, the average cost of a residential care home in the UK is £1,160 per week, while nursing homes average £1,410 per week. Luxury or specialist homes can exceed £1,500 per week.
(Source: Carehome.co.uk)

For couples, the cost doubles—two residents mean £2,320+ per week, compared to £1,295 for live-in care for two people. That’s a saving of over £1,000 per week.


Why Live-In Care is Better Value – Benefits of live in care

At first glance, live-in care may seem similar in cost to a care home. Here is a summary of care homes vs live in care:

  • One-to-One Care: Care homes have staff attending to multiple residents, while live-in care offers dedicated support.
  • Stay at Home: No need to sell your property or downsize—your home remains yours.
  • Personalised Routine: Eat when you want, keep your pets, and maintain your lifestyle.
  • Emotional Wellbeing: Familiar surroundings reduce stress and confusion, especially for those with dementia.

For couples, the financial advantage is clear: live-in care costs no more than single-person care, while care home fees double.
